Club Spirit - Testimonial
Lil Waters – Club Manager, Milton Keynes
I joined Spirit Health Clubs in 1998 after graduating from university with a Sports Studies Degree. After looking at the various health club providers in the industry, I was impressed with the training that Spirit Health Clubs provide. Within a year-and-a-half I had completed my Gym Instructor, Advanced Instructor and Management Certificate qualifications. Following on from this I became a Regional Recruitment Representative, as well as becoming a Deputy Club Manager at one of the clubs.
I have now progressed and been a Club Manager for four years, whilst still assisting the region with my Training and Resourcing Coordinator role. Within this role I have completed my City and Guilds Certificate in Delivering Learning qualification, and I am currently completing my OCR A1 qualification. I enjoy helping other team members within Spirit Health Clubs with the training for their instructor qualifications and also on their assessment days. Active IQ certifies the instructor qualifications, which is a leading provider of qualifications in the industry.
I thoroughly enjoy working for Spirit Health Clubs, and I am keen to continue to progress within the company. What’s more, continuous development is provided which contributes to my renewal with REPs every year.
As a Club Manager the skills required are varied, and every day in the club is different. As a Training and Resourcing Coordinator, this gives me the opportunity to help others to learn skills that I have developed over the years and help them in their development.
